I love root beer. Every time I see a new one I just have to try it. So far I have I have had about 20 root beers, birch beers and sarsaparillas, so I thought I would right a quick guide/mini review on them. *All ratings are on scale of 1 to 10.
A&W: 3 of 10
I do not really consider this a good root beer, because most good root beers will come in a glass bottle, but it is one of the most common. It does not have much flavor, and it is a little to sweet. Probably, the sweetness woud be perfect except for the lack of flavor. But it will do if there is no pother root beer to be had.
Sea Dog Root Beer: 8 1/2 of 10
Yes! Now we are into GOOD root beers. I like this one a lot. It just has a good flavor, and nothing really weird about it. I often prefer birch beer and sarsaparillas to true root beers, but this is one of my favorites.
Boylan's Root Beer: 3 1/2 of 10
This root beer is very unusual. It gets most of it's flavor from "Pure yucka extract" (I am pretty sure I spelled yucka wrong, so please correct me if you know how it's spelled. Better yet, mod it if you are a mod) It's not bad, but I do not enjoy it as much as some more normal root beers.
Boylan's Birch Beer: 7 of 10
Now this is good! I like this much more than their root beer. It tastes like birch beer, and not some strange beverage from.... somewhere strange like the root beer. Like the root beer, it is sweetened with cane sugar, which I find always makes root beer better. (Except when there is just no hope for the drink lol)
IBC: 5 of 10
This root beer is very common and easy to find. It is one of my favorites, because it just tastes like root beer. It has a kinda sharp bite, but usually not to much of one to make it bad. It is right in the middle of root beers imo. Not the greatest, but not by any means the worst.
Sioux City sodas
I am going to make this a whole section, because I didn't want to type "Sioux City 3-5 times lol".
ROOT BEER: 4 1/2 of 10
I was expecting a very good root beer from Sioux City, but this is only alright. It doesn't taste at all bad, it just doesn't have any different exiting flavor.
SARSAPARILLA: 8 2/3 of 10
This is very good. I like it a lot, and would drink it almost any time. Very good flavor, good sweetness, and not to much carbonation.
BIRCH BEER: 9 of 10
May just be my favorite drink. It is very refreshing and almost bursting with flavor. It is a red birch beer, which is kinda cool, and the have in the last few months switched from a brown bottle to a clear bottle to show off the color. The birch flavor is nice, and there is also a little mint flavor I think, which is common for a birch beer.
Sprecher root beer: 5 of 10
This root beer is pretty good. It is sweetened with honey, which I usually don't like in a root beer, but they pull it off. It is around the same level with IBC, but I might like IBC a little more. But this comes in a 16 oz bottle. (YAY!) Any excuse to drink more root beer lol.
Olde Brooklyn root beer: 2
Ok, I don't like this at all. And it's MADE BY SIOUX CITY!!!!!!! Ok, anyway, it doesn't have much flavor, and the flavor it does have kinda tasts like medicine. I don't like it.
